What Are Car Key Services?

Car key services encompass a variety of tasks associated with automobile keys, consisting of:

  1. Key Duplication: Making copies of existing keys for spare usage.
  2. Key Replacement: Creating new keys when originals are lost or harmed.
  3. Key Programming: Configuring transponder keys and key fobs to deal with a vehicle's immobilizer system.
  4. Ignition Repair and Replacement: Handling issues related to faulty ignitions or changing the ignition system totally.
  5. Emergency Situation Lockout Services: Assisting people who are locked out of their lorries.

Kinds Of Car Keys

Before diving deeper into car key services, it's vital to understand the different types of keys that contemporary automobiles utilize:

Key TypeDescription
Conventional KeyBasic metal keys that run mechanical locks.
Transponder KeyIncludes a ch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ition to avoid theft.
Remote Key FobKeyless entry gadgets that permit motorists to unlock and begin their vehicle without placing a key.
Smart KeyAdvanced innovation that can start the vehicle with distance detection and push-button ignition.

Typical Car Key Issues and Solutions

Here's a table showing some of the common car key issues vehicle owners face and the possible options readily available:

IssueSolution
Lost KeyKey replacement through a locksmith or car dealership.
Broken KeyKey repair or duplication of a new key.
Ignition ProblemsIgnition repair or total replacement.
Remote Not WorkingBattery replacement or reprogramming the remote.
Key Fob IssuesReprogramming or buying a new key fob.

FAQs About Car Key Services

  1. What is the average expense of car key replacement?

    • The expense can differ commonly depending on the type of key. Traditional keys might begin around ₤ 2-5, while transponder keys can range from ₤ 70 to ₤ 250, and smart keys can go beyond ₤ 300.
  2. For how long does it take to replace a car key?

    • Normally, it can take anywhere from 10 minutes for a basic key duplication to over an hour for more complicated key programming or ignition issues.
  3. Can I set my own key?

    • Some car owners can configure their own keys by following specific procedures in the vehicle's manual. However, advanced keys typically need professional equipment.
  4. What should I do if my key gets stuck in the ignition?

    • Attempt carefully wiggling the key while turning it. If it doesn't budge, consider calling an expert to avoid damaging the ignition.
